Summary

Overview

In 2024, Amritsar averaged an AQI of 124 while Tālcher averaged 127 — a 3-point (2%) gap, with Tālcher the more polluted and Amritsar the cleaner of the two. On 1507 days when both cities reported, Amritsar was cleaner on 785 of them; the average daily gap was 65 AQI points.

Seasonality & days

Amritsar peaks in November, while Tālcher peaks in December. Amritsar logged 0.2% Severe days and 47.2% Good-or-Satisfactory days; Tālcher was 0.2% Severe and 43.1% Good-or-Satisfactory. Longest clean-air streaks: Amritsar 40 days, Tālcher 44 days.

Year-over-year progress

Amritsar has improved by 40 AQI points (24.4%) from 2017 to 2024; Tālcher has improved by 63 AQI points (33.2%) over the same window. The worst recorded day for Amritsar reached AQI 459 at Golden Temple (PPCB) on 2018-06-14; Tālcher hit AQI 414 at Talcher (OSPCB) on 2018-11-27.
